This means they are not serialized against drivers that update queue limits inside a freeze window. A bio that passes validation under old limits can enter the queue after the update and reach the driver with an invalid configuration. This series moves all limit-dependent validation into __bio_split_to_limits(), which runs after the queue usage reference has been acquired. This ensures proper serialization against limit updates. But a bio that passed bio_check_eod() before the freeze can still reach nvme_setup_rw() after the update, triggering a WARN that we didn't expect to be possible of reaching. For NVMe multipath, moving these checks into the entered context exacerbates a different problem: a bio targeting a path being torn down (capacity set to 0) would be failed by the block layer before the driver gets a chance to redirect it to another path. This is a pre-existing problem, but the initial changes in this series make it easier to hit. The series addresses this by introducing a new callback to block_device_operations, called from bio_io_error(), that lets the driver intercept and redirect failing bios before they are completed. NVMe multipath uses this to requeue bios back to the head device for path re-selection when the path is no longer ready. Note that callers of submit_bio_noacct_nocheck() (bio split, throttle dispatch) will now hit the validation checks in __bio_split_to_limits() that they previously bypassed. This is intentional: these checks must run in the entered context to be properly serialized, and cannot be skipped so it is a performance cost that can't be avoided.
